In a distressing incident that has captured the attention of many, authorities report that an inmate killed his wife during a prison visitation in eastern Germany. The tragic event, which took place in one of the facilities noted for its efforts to rehabilitate offenders, raises serious concerns regarding prison safety and inmate management.
According to prosecutors, the fatal encounter occurred in a private visitation area where inmates often meet family members. Witnesses claim that the atmosphere abruptly shifted from one of familial warmth to sheer horror. Immediate medical attention was summoned, but unfortunately, it was too late to save the victim.
